What is RTP?
RTP represents the percentage of all wagered money that a slot machine returns to players over time. For example, a slot with a 96% RTP theoretically returns $96 for every $100 wagered. It’s important to remember this is calculated over thousands of spins, not individual sessions.
Why RTP Matters to Players
Understanding RTP helps you make informed decisions about which games to play. Higher RTP slots generally offer better long-term value, though luck still plays the primary role in short-term outcomes. Most reputable online casinos display RTP information in their game details.
Finding Games with Favorable RTPs
– High RTP slots: 96% or above – Medium RTP slots: 94-96% – Lower RTP slots: Below 94%
Choosing games with RTPs above 95% gives you slightly better odds, though results vary considerably.
